body {margin-top: 25px; margin-left: auto; margin-right: auto;background-color: #000000; color: #ffffff;text-align: center; font-family: perpetua, times, serif;}
#footer {width: 100%; text-align: center; background-color: #000000; color: #545454;margin-top:10px;}
#footer a:link {background-color: #000000; color: #666666;}
#footer a:visited {background-color: #000000; color: #666666;}
#footer a:hover {background-color: #000000; color: #999999;}

#corps {position: relative; width: 800px; height: 550px; background-color: #481913; color: inherit; margin-left: auto; margin-right: auto;}
h1 {position: absolute; top: 85px !important; left: 2% !important; top: 115px; left: 2%; z-index: 2; background-image: url(../images/carre.gif);color: #d28e05; font-size: 2.8em; font-family: 'itc baskerville', times, serif; font-weight: lighter;}
#vlad {float: right; width: 407px; height: 550px; background: url(../images/fond-accueil02low.jpg); background-repeat: no-repeat; padding-top: 0; padding-right: 0;}
#logo {position: absolute; top : 35px; left : 2%; width: 250px; height: 103px; background: url(../images/logo.gif); background-repeat: no-repeat; z-index: 1;}
#langue {position:absolute;top:510px;left:40px;width:30px;height:25px}
img {border:0px}
#menu {position: absolute; top : 195px; left : -2%;background-color: transparent;color: #d28e05; font-size: 1.5em; text-align: left;font-family: 'itc baskerville', times, serif; }
#menu a:link {background-color: inherit;color: #d28e05;}
#menu a:visited {background-color: inherit;color: #d28e05;}
#menu a:hover {background-color: inherit;color: #ecc16b;}
#maj {position:absolute;top:500px !important;top:520px;left:300px;color: #d28e05;}
ul {list-style: none}
